Expression and clinical significance of miR-653-5p in colon cancer patients

Abstract: OBJECTIVE: To investigate expressions of microRNA miR-653-5p in the serum of colon cancer patients and their clinical significance. METHODS: From January 2019 to January 2020,76 colon cancer patients who were treated in the First People’s Hospital of Shangqiu City were selected as the experimental group,and 76 healthy physical examiners in the same period were selected as the observation group. From the collection of 5 mL of fasting venous blood from the subjects,serum miRNA was extracted. Real-time quantitative fluorescence PCR (qPCR) was used to detect expression levels of miR-653-5p,and their differences between the two groups were compared. According to the relative expression level of miR-653-5p,the colon cancer patients in the experimental group were divided into high and low expression groups,and the correlation between miR-653-5p expression and the clinicopathological indicators of colon cancer were analyzed. The clinical diagnostic value of miR-653-5p was analyzed by using the receiver operating characteristic curve (ROC). Kaplan-Meier and multivariate COX regression were used to analyze factors influencing colon cancer survival prognosis. RESULTS: The relative expression level of miR-653-5p in the serum of the control group was 0.622±1.319,and was 0.471±1.076 for the patients,which was significantly lower than that in the control group (P<0.01). There were no significant correlations between the expression levels of miR-653-5p and the sex,age,tumor location and size of colon cancer patients (P>0.05),but they were related to clinical T stages,distant metastasis,lymph node metastasis,vascular cancer thrombus and tumor differentiation (all P<0.01). The area under the curve of miR-653-5p for clinical diagnosis of colon cancer was 0.823 (P<0.01),the cut-off value was 0.498,the sensitivity was 80.26%,and the specificity was 82.89%. The Kaplan-Meier curve showed that the survival rate of colon cancer patients in the high-expression group of miR-653-5p was significantly higher than that in the low-expression group (P<0.01). COX regression analysis showed that miR-653-5p expression levels,clinical T stages,distant metastasis,lymph node metastasis,and tumor differentiation were independent risk factors affecting the prognosis and survival of colon cancer patients (all P<0.01). CONCLUSION: The expression levels of miR-653-5p in the serum of colon cancer patients were significantly down-regulated. Our results suggest that miR-653-5p may be a useful and novel biomarker for the diagnosis and prognosis evaluation of colon cancer.
